Since I started working with metal I have been fascinated by this versatile material. To create subtle and vulnerable things like flowers from a hard, cold material that can only be shaped with force and heat is a captivating process. I research the anatomy of a flower extensively before I make it out of metal, to create life-like, much bigger versions.

Every piece of metalart is unique because it is crafted by hand. I use a lot of different techniques to get the right shape: cutting, welding, grinding, forging, plasma cutting and a lot of hammering. See videos and pictures of these different processes below.
